Mandiant Says Hackers Stole a 'Significant Volume of Data' From Snowflake Customers

Security researchers say they believe financially motivated cybercriminals have stolen a "significant volume of data" from hundreds of customers hosting their vast banks of data with cloud storage giant Snowflake. TechCrunch: Incident response firm Mandiant, which is working with Snowflake to investigate the recent spate of data thefts, said in a blog post Monday that the two firms have notified around 165 customers that their data may have been stolen. It's the first time that the number of affected Snowflake customers has been disclosed since the account hacks began in April.
